Abstract
1,011,207. Pneumatic separators. COLLECTION Ltd., and D. SUMMERS. Sept. 25, 1964 [Sept. 27, 1963], No. 38257/63. Heading B2H. An apparatus for separating particulate solid material according to size or density comprises a substantially vertical duct 10, Fig. 1, or 45, Fig. 2, opening at its top end into a transverse duct 11 or 46, a feed tube 24 or 61 through which the material is fed downwardly into the duct 10 or 45 and extending downwardly through the duct 11 or 46 to a position below the top of the duct 10 or 45, means for producing an upwardly flowing current of air at a predetermined velocity in the duct 10 or 45 so as to carry upwardly the smaller or lighter particles, means for producing another current of air in the duct 11 or 46 in order to convey the smaller and lighter particles along that duct, and means at the bottom of the duct 10 or 45 for collecting the larger or heavier particles. In Fig. 1, the material to be separated is fed from a hopper 26 via a screw conveyer 27 into the feed tube 24, agglomerations in the material being broken by apertured discs 28, 29 which rotate in opposite direction to each other in the tube 24. Air is fed to the ducts 10, 11 by means of a blower &c. 18. A flap 23 regulates the air flow in the duct 11 and in a transverse duct 13 leading to the duct 10. The air passing from the duct 13 is distributed evenly in the duct 10 by means of vertically overlapping rings 15. The heavier or larger particles are collected in a bag 17 while the lighter or smaller particles are conveyed to a cyclone 19 where the air is exhausted at 22 and the particles are collected in a bag 21 or are discharged through a valve. In Fig. 2, the feed tube 61 is rotatably mounted in the duct 45 and terminates in a fish-tail spreader portion 62 opening above a guiding grid 68. A sleeve 67 serves to adjust the air gap between the tube 61 and the hopper 66 so as to adjust the rate of flow of air drawn into the tube and hence to vary the speed of fall of the feed material. The two air currents are produced by air sucked through the apparatus by a fan 58 via ducts 46 and 48 provided with butterfly valves 53, 54 which are coupled by a link 55 for simultaneous operation. The heavier or larger particles are discharged through a valve 52. The feed arrangement of Fig. 1 can be used in the apparatus of Fig. 2 and vice versa. The apparatus may be used for treating tea so as to separate dust and very small leaf particles from the leaf fragments of more normal size.
